Considering Sigh’s varied sonic experiments over the years, you need to focus primarily on the material in front of your ears. Past records have explored various forms of rock (’70s-style prog meets proto-metal), classic metal (NWOBHM meets ’80s Japan), thrash (German-flavored) and black metal (sometimes Bathory or Venom-like, other times more avant-garde). Recently, they’ve created various symphonic forms of grim, dabbling in atmospheric and orchestrated sounds, attempting to replicate the feel of Italian horror movie soundtracks and, allegedly, German-style classical music. (Check out 2007’s Hangman’s Hymn for reference.)
Sounds cool on paper, and fans of Sigh’s past few records, which likewise stuff classical strings-and-things inside the confines of dirge-y, thrash-y, blasting metal will most likely dig this, um, interesting mish-mash. But unfortunately, to these ears, most of these extreme contrasts don’t gel. For starters, what is being coined as “otherworldly symphonic” sounds (ambitiously created by strings, oboe, clarinet, flute, tuba, trombone, trumpet, etc.), has no force or proper blending in the mix due to spotty production, and ends up sounding like budget synthesizers. The fact that raw and juicy first-wave BM riffs keep getting sat on (the classical bits are way too loud) by cornball melodies that sound like German folk/drinking tunes or dancing-pirate jigs does not help things. This is clearly a case where a band’s “visionary” leader needs to be reined in by a producer.
Hints of genius actually do manage to waft through the mounds of cheese. Not counting the, um, saxophone solos, tracks like “Musica in Tempora Belli” (featuring a cool spoken word bit by Current 93’s David Tibet) and “Vanitas” somehow keep things less Euro Disney and more horror movie, which nearly-kinda-sorta works. Sorta.
